<p>I&#8217;m a huge fan of both stand-up and ground-game. I have said this many times before to anyone who will listen: Mazzagatti does not know when to stand up fighters and when to leave them on the ground.</p>
<p>In my personal opinion and any one who appreciates MMA the way a true fan should is that fighters should only stay on the ground if they are throwing elbows (ground-n-poundin), throwing punches, workin submissions, or attempting to gain position (side/full mount, etc).</p>
<p>What I&#8217;ve noticed with Mazzagatti on countless ocassions and especially when you have at least 1 decent wrestler fighting is he will allow the wrestler to lay on top of his opponent for most of a round (and in effect, winning the round without doing much more than laying on his opponent).</p>
<p>There is a huge difference between appreciating the ground game and letting fighters win rounds (sometimes entire fights)by just laying on top of their opponent.</p>
